Job Title

This position reports directly to the SM/Environmental Laboratory Supervisor and works closely with the Environmental Group in carrying out the duties of the job.

Completes reporting requirements as required per the SM/Environmental Lab Supervisor and/or the Environmental Lab Group Leader.

May serve as upgrade for SM/Environmental Lab Supervisor in their absence and back up for SM Process Lab Specialist in their absence.

Perform assignments in a manner consistent with established procedures, and directly responsible for personal safety, as well as the safety of their co-workers.

Will participate on problem solving teams such as incident investigation, safety committees, process hazard analysis, continuous improvement, turnaround preparation, and other loss control related projects.

Actively support all policies and management systems to foster continual improvement, conformance with legal and other requirements to which the organization subscribes the prevention of pollution and customer satisfaction

Activities

Assists the SM/Environmental Lab Supervisor with the maintenance and upkeep of lab instrumentation and equipment in the Environmental Lab.

Oversees the work activities and assists with training of the Environmental Lab Technicians.

Provides support to Technical and other departments in the science of chemistry as it relates to plant operations, wastewater treatment, and environmental control.

Maintains the calibration and standards programs for the lab equipment.

Coordinates, performs or assists with special projects as directed.

Responsible for performance of scheduled routine analyses, housekeeping, and other activities or special projects as directed.

Develop and implement test methods and standards of performance necessary to meet Laboratory objectives (including ISO 9001).

Responsible for maintaining laboratory instruments in working order. Includes being knowledgeable in the operation, troubleshooting, and upkeep of all laboratory instruments and equipment; ensures that preventive maintenance, calibration and quality checks are conducted on lab equipment as scheduled or when needed as indicated by QC problems.

Responsible for assigned physical and chemical tests on ground water, benzene waste, wastewater discharges and permit samples including established documentation procedures.

Responsible for updating and maintaining lab procedures in the Environmental Lab Manual.

Candidate Profile

This position requires a Bachelor of Science in Chemistry or related technical degree.

Minimum of 3 years laboratory experience required.

Good supervisory skills, computer skills, and quality control skills. Lab instrument knowledge and maintenance skills are essential.

As primary for oversight of lab operations, would be on call 24 hours per day.
